Usage Protocol
  1. Remove the marked edge in the center of the spot .
  2. Transfer the filter paper to a 1.5ml microfuge tube containing 150-200 μl of sterile H2O . Ensure the filter paper is completely immersed in the H2O by briefly centrifuging the tube for 10 seconds.
  3. Transfer the tube to a heating block at 95℃ for 15-30 min.
  4. At the end of the incubation period remove the sample from the block and pulse vortex, or gently tap.
  5. Briefly centrifuge for 30 seconds, to separate the scattered filter paper from the elute. The elute now contains the purified DNA .
